High Tunnel Greenhouse Produces Higher Cut Flower Yields In Utah, Maegen Lewis Mar 2019

High Tunnel Greenhouse Produces Higher Cut Flower Yields In Utah, Maegen Lewis

Research on Capitol Hill

  • Utah State University is performing research to develop management guidelines for cut flower production.
  • High tunnels, simple inexpensive greenhouses, moderate temperatures. This allows cut flowers to be grown despite unfavorable conditions.
  • Snapdragon (Antirrhinum majus) and sweet pea (Lathyrus odoratus) were selected as cool season annual crops to evaluate high tunnel benefits during cool spring temperatures.
  • Research will be used to develop crop management guidelines for cut flower growers in Utah.


Survey Of Bird/Window Collisions At Utah State University-Brigham City, Spencer Smith Mar 2019

Survey Of Bird/Window Collisions At Utah State University-Brigham City, Spencer Smith

Research on Capitol Hill

When birds fly at full speed into the highly reflective glass windows of human structures, death is often the outcome. This research investigates the impact of architecture on bird population through a specific case study. Bird/window collisions claim from around 350 million to over 1 billion birds per year (Kahle, Flannery, & Dumbacher, 2016). Studies have shown that window surface area (Borden, Lockhart, Jones, & Lyons, 2011) can increase incidents of bird-window collisions. Establishment Of Fuel Breaks To Protect Sage-Grouse Habitat In Northwest Utah, William Price Mar 2019

Establishment Of Fuel Breaks To Protect Sage-Grouse Habitat In Northwest Utah, William Price

Research on Capitol Hill

One of the largest threats to greater sage-grouse (Centrocercus ursophasianus) is habitat loss due to wildfire. Cheatgrass is an invasive annual grass that increases the frequency and severity of wildfire, creating an even larger threat to sage-grouse.

One approach to protect sage-grouse habitat is to implement fuel breaks of perennial grasses to slow the spread of wildfire. Perennial grasses are used in these fuel breaks because they stay green longer into the summer and are more resistant to the spread of fire.
